The rain, the cold and the storm on the way did not stop the thousands of Hapoel Pat and MS Ashdod fans from coming to the Shlomo Insurance Stadium this evening (Tuesday) and watching their teams draw 1:1 in the first game of the quarter-finals of the State Cup.
The blue crowd came in large numbers and did not stop encouraging the team's players, even though they fell behind in the fourth minute after Hamodi Kanaan scored the first goal of the guest with a penalty.
Surprisingly, Ofer Tselappa's men continued their good form from the National League and looked much better than their opponents from the top league.

Dror Nir balanced the result in the 43rd minute after she lifted a ball into the area that passed all the players and misled the goalkeeper Yoav Hasson, and the hopes for Cinderella in the semi-finals returned.
Even in the second half the good pace continued, both teams were looking for another goal that would give them an advance for the rematch that will be held on 28.2 in Ashdod, but without success.
In the end 1:1, which can give the group from the mother of the colonies many reasons for optimism and little food for thought on the side of Ran Ben Shimon and Ashdod.
